How to Become Self Educated
- Be obedient: It absolutely means being obedient with your seniors and of course parents. Impress them and also try to drag their attention. Always show your elders that you are mature and you are fully gracious.
- Be honest: Self educating yourself in religion is the easiest. Always be honest with everything. And respect every religion.
- Associate yourself with educated people, groups, discussions.
- Try to behave like an educated person, no matter how you are but just try to act and learn from your failures.
- Study or read something everyday, if possible join a course or college to get a degree or few certificates at least.
- Try improve your linguistic skills as much as possible by reading something everyday.
- Observe good educated habits and behaviour of educated people.
- If possible try to set small goals or choose a leader to follow.
